Hey I have a question, if anybody can help me out. My husband has to leave a couple of days early and I am not sure what to do about the Magical Express Stuff. If I call Disney and tell them that he is leaving early and needs the Magical Express a couple of days before the kids and I do, will that end up affecting my meal credits? We got free dinning. Should we just call him a cab? Disney doesn't have to know...and then what happens when he doesn't show up for Magical Express. Am I over thinking this?

The Magical Express has no bearing on the meal stuff. I wouldn't worry about that part. But as far as the actual M.E. service goes, they're going to show up at the time and day that you have booked. They probably won't split it up between two separate occasions. So whatever you booked when you made your reservations is what they're going to go by. There probably really isn't any way to apply it to two different pickup times. The main reason being that they tie it to certain arrival and departure flights of the airlines, so they run a set schedule and book individuals based on that. It would be very hard for them to add one person to a particular pickup route if he wasn't tied to a certain flight that they already had on record. They run their buses with the expectation that they will have a certain number of people tied to specific flights.
But of course, it never hurts to ask... Disney being all about Magic and all.... they may be able to figure out whether a certain bus is not full and can handle an extra passenger. Don't know how they could track the luggage though....
Well, anyway... I guess you oughta just call 'em...
